Pension Risk Transfer Specialist - 108897
Base Location: London, Manchester, Birmingham or Bristol
KPMG’s Pensions Advisory continues to build out its new pensions team and requires individuals that can bring different skill-sets to the team. We are looking for a talented Director to join our team, who will be responsible for building and leading our pension risk transfer proposition.
As a Director, you will be responsible for effective collaboration within teams, supervising the work of junior staff, and providing coaching and development to assist them in the effective delivery of engagements.
Why join KPMG as a Pension Risk Transfer Specialist?
KPMG is one of the world's largest and most respected consultancy businesses and the successful candidate will have the opportunity to be part of the rapidly growing Pensions Advisory team. In addition, the candidate will be able to shape and influence the team’s new pension risk transfer service.
What will you be doing?
- Building the proposition and the internal knowledge infrastructure around insurer research, pricing mechanisms, vendor selection material and client reporting
- Leveraging internal networks and relationships to identify opportunities
- Developing corporate and trustee networks, maintain relationships and help create the KPMG pensions brand and opportunities in the risk transfer space
- Creating sales and marketing materials, building quality pipeline and leading presentations to win new business
- Training other team members and passing on knowledge to create a high-performing capability in the pension risk transfer market.

What will you need to do it?
- Proven track record in leading team and building propositions
- Hands-on experience of delivering pension risk transfer transactions
- Detailed knowledge of how pension risk transfer interacts with funding, investment and accounting, and an ability to drive and oversee data readiness
- UK qualified actuary (or equivalent)
- A mature network of trustee contacts and relationships with insurers
- Experience of managing and motivating teams, coaching and mentoring junior staff
